Q: Is 167,195 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 167,195 is a composite number.

Why is 167,195 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 167,195 can be evenly divided by 1 5 7 17 35 85 119 281 595 1,405 1,967 4,777 9,835 23,885 33,439 and 167,195, with no remainder.

Since 167,195 cannot be divided by just 1 and 167,195, it is a composite number.
